a few quick questions first

what sort of setup do your friends typically use?
are they using tube or solid state amps? (HUGE tone difference... especially once the tubes warm up)...
are they using multi-effects units like your GNX or individual pedals?

personally i'd bring the GNX to your friends house with your guitar and try it out next time you visit... could just be the default presets that suck (like they always do)... while there i'd also write down their amp settings and try those out on the peavey... but odds are you've got some quality time with the GNX technical manual waiting for you... if you bought it used and don't have the manual...
